| Résumé: | In the present degree work, it was designed an Android application oriented to the calculation of power transmissions by normal type roller chains, whose calculation methodology is based on methods applied in books such as (Budynas & Nisbett, 2008), catalogues as (Joresa, 2010), handbooks such as (Nieto, López, & Galvis, 2011), engineering software as Autodesk Inventor 2020®; in addition, these were also complemented with other catalogues, handbooks and texts with similar methodologies. As final result, it was obtained the chain feature according to ANSI B29 and ISO 606 standards, geometric data of the chain, power capacity, type of lubrication, and useful life of the chain, all these were based on the standards previously mentioned. Likewise, optimizing time and possible errors that occur when performing it manually. For the calculation of the useful life, it was obtained a series of equations from curves proposed by Autodesk Inventor 2020® with the help of Microsoft Excel® engineering software. The first step was to carry out a bibliographic search regarding transmissions by normal type roller chains. Then, a methodology was defined to establish a mathematical model to obtain the chain pitch, considering this an empirical method which is based on information from catalogues. The methodology used for the solution of the problem was of Lee and Christensen and the Nassi-Scheirman matrix; in addition, with the help of the dichromatic graph method, it was obtained the graph algorithm, which was used for the development of the programming in Android studio®, assigning the name to the system "Transmission Chains". In order to validate the application, it was necessary to carry out eight exercises proposed by texts referring to mechanical design, catalogues, handbooks of roller chain transmission standard and exercises proposed by the thesis tutor. Likewise, the results obtained were checked manually through the Transmission Chains application giving an average error of 0.06%. |
